Product Description

The "Lee Hon Kong Kai" typeface includes over 7,000 Chinese characters, covering 99.9% of daily application needs, along with Zhuyin phonetic symbols, English letters, numbers, Chinese financial numerals, and commonly used punctuation marks. It utilizes a widely compatible font format, suitable for mainstream operating systems and software. This typeface features moderately thick and clear strokes, easily distinguishable. Its most distinctive characteristic is the integrated design, making it particularly suitable for a variety of applications such as signage, handicrafts, 3D lettering, festive titles, print advertising, digital media design, posters, banners, and product packaging. We hope "Lee Hon Kong Kai" offers users more font choices, allowing this Hong Kong-inspired calligraphy style to continue and be rediscovered. Selection Tip: Please note the difference between "Lee Hon Kong Kai" and "Lee Hon Tung Kai": ✒ Lee Hon Kong Kai (李漢港楷) • A font digitized from the handwriting of Hong Kong street sign calligraphy master, Mr. Lee Hon. • Features compact, integrated strokes designed for the Hong Kong street sign style of the 1970s-1990s, fully preserving the visual characteristics of that era. • The name "Kong Kai" not only signifies "Hong Kong Kai Shu" (Hong Kong Regular Script) but also cleverly sounds like "Look at Hong Kong Street" (你看港街), highlighting its deep cultural roots. • Based on Master Lee Hon's original drafts, it was officially released in 2020 after years of curation, dedicated to preserving Hong Kong's street sign culture. 🖋 Lee Hon Tung Kai (李漢通楷) • "Tung Kai" is a derivative version of "Kong Kai," specifically designed for stencil cutting and engraving. • "Tung" refers to "Tong Fa" (perforated patterns) or "Gou Tung Zi" (connected characters), where the character's core is linked to its outer frame to prevent separation during production or coloring. • The design incorporates bridging structures to ensure strokes remain intact during the physical stencil creation process. • It is the first professional perforated font based on traditional Chinese characters, ideal for physical production needs like engraving and spray-painted signs.
